ADC1001 General Description
The ADC1001 is a CMOS, 10-bit successive approximation A/D converter. The 20-pin ADC1001 is pin compatible with the ADC0801 8-bit A/D family. The 10-bit data word is read in two 8-bit bytes, formatted left justified and high byte first. The six least significant bits of the second byte are set to zero, as is proper for a 16-bit word.
Differential inputs provide low frequency input common mode rejection and allow offsetting the analog range of the converter. In addition, the reference input can be adjusted enabling the conversion of reduced analog ranges with 10-bit resolution.
ADC1001 Maximum Ratings
If Military/Aerospace specified devices are required, please contact the National Semiconductor Sales Office/Distributors for availability and specifications.
Supply Voltage (VCC) (Note 3) ..............6.5V
Logic Control Inputs.............. −0.3V to +18V
Voltage at Other Inputs and Outputs.. −0.3V to (VCC+0.3V)
Storage Temperature Range .........−65 to +150
Package Dissipation at TA=25 ......... ..875 mW
Lead Temp. (Soldering, 10 seconds) ....... ...300
ESD Susceptibility (Note 10)............... 800V
ADC1001 Features
`ADC1001 is pin compatible with ADC0801 series 8-bit A/D converters
`Compatible with NSC800 and 8080 P derivatives-no interfacing logic needed
`Easily interfaced to 6800 P derivatives
`Differential analog voltage inputs
` Logic inputs and outputs meet both MOS and TTL voltage level specifications
`Works with 2.5V (LM336) voltage reference
`On-chip clock generator
`0V to 5V analog input voltage range with single 5V supply
`Operates ratiometrically or with 5 VDC, 2.5 VDC, or analog span adjusted voltage reference
`0.3" standard width 20-pin DIP package
